Key Differences between iPaaS and MFT

When considering an MFT solution for an enterprise integration platform, it’s important to understand the key differences between iPaaS and MFT:

  iPaaS Thru’s MFT
APIs and Connectors Extensive set of APIs and connectors General set of file protocols and APIs
Data Exchange Near real-time or not real-time and synchronous Batch, near real-time or not real-time and synchronous
Payload Size (File size and number of files) Small to medium Unlimited
Persistence (Store files until delivery) No or limited persistence Unlimited persistence
Data Transformation Capability Yes No
Type of Connection Mostly point-to-point connections One flow for hundreds of partners
Guaranteed Delivery Requires special programming Built in, unlimited payloads
